Sat 1331581199877133

decimal
322632.1199877133
degree
0°112632′72″1199877133‴
percentile
63.40862863532728%
name
ekmqxfbpczs
cycle
0
epoch
1
period
160
block
322632
offset
1199877133
timestamp
rarity
common